May 25, 2010

Cagayan de Oro, Philippines – “Touchin
g other people's lives is very heart warming especially when you have made them smile. A simple gesture of reaching a hand to the ones in need is already a great success to each one of us” said Vincent Ofngol, member of the Independent Order of Odd Fellows, Kapatirang Mindanaon Lodge no.2, during their charity drive for unfortunate children and rural communities in Brgy. Opol, Misamis Oriental.

Their first stop was in the community o
f Sitio Mala-Oro where they donated trash cans to the community and over 83 school supplies for the children. Afterwards, they continued their journey to the community of Zone 7 Landless where over 91 students were given school supplies.

The activity ended with heart warming smiles and feelings of fulfilment. “Moments like this makes you reflect how thankful we are. So give love back” said Aaron Ofngol.

“The Independent Order of Odd Fellows is a worldwide charitable 
and fraternal organization with over 10,000 lodges in about 26 countries. Internationally, members are involved in various national and local charitable efforts. For many, the Odd Fellows is considered a family fraternity dedicated to making the world a better place through fraternal friendship, charitable love and the pursuit of truth in all their dealings.”
